Step 4
When you feel that you have the best position for the post pivot bracket in the closed position, insert the 5/16" bolt
through the aligned holes of the post bracket and post pivot bracket to hold it in place. Remove the clevis pin from the
front mount and while supporting the gate opener, swing the gate and gate opener to the open position. With the gate
and gate opener in the open position check the clearance and be sure that the gate opener is not binding at the post
pivot bracket.
If you don't have 2 inches of clearance or the gate opener is binding on the post pivot bracket, remove the 5/16" bolt and
readjust the pivot bracket until you can achieve these important clearances. Make sure to reinstall the bolt and related
hardware as shown in step 1.
With the post pivot bracket in the optimum position for clearance and freedom of movement while maintaining 19 inches
or less on the stroke. Reattach the opener to the gate bracket in the open position and recheck the gate opener level and
make sure the brackets are clamped securely.
